About Reserves of Auburn Hills Reserves at Auburn Hills is a new active adult community in Auburn Hills, Michigan. With plans for 68 attached homes, this low-maintenance community offers two distinct floor plans with many standard features and customization options. In close proximity to Interstate 75, Reserves at Auburn Hills sits next to the community’s private four-acre nature pReserves. Reserves at Auburn Hills Amenities & Lifestyle In this low-maintenance community residents have more time to enjoy their time and relax as a homeowners’ association takes care of maintaining the common areas, as well as providing full-service lawn maintenance for each home, and snow plowing when needed. Residents instead spend their time enjoying the community’s outdoor gazebo and walking trail that leads to the scenic pond located on the communities own four-acre nature preserve. Residents can also take advantage of a community sports court. Reserves at Auburn Hills Homes & Real Estate Grandview Building Inc. plans to build 62 attached homes in the Reserves at Auburn Hills. Homebuyers have two different floor plans to choose from, the Bradford and the Chatham. These homes range from 1,350 to 1,850 square feet. They include two bedrooms, two or two-and-a-half bathrooms, and attached two-car garages. Some features and options for these homes include vaulted ceilings in the living and dining rooms, granite countertops in the kitchens, open-concept floor plans, walk-in showers, and first-floor laundry rooms. Some homes also include full basements. Surrounding Area Reserves at Auburn Hills in Auburn Hills, Michigan is located 35 miles north of Detroit. For everyday shopping needs and conveniences, there is a Walmart Supercenter, Meijer, Bank of America, and a PetSmart all just ten minutes from Reserves at Auburn Hills. The community’s location adjacent to Interstate 75 makes driving around the area easy. Civic Center Park is a popular destination locally and includes several nature trails, a fishing pond, picnic areas, tennis courts, a softball field, and more. The 16-mile Clinton River Trail also runs through Auburn Hills and is perfect for walking and biking. Fieldstone Golf Club is 3 miles away and offers special discounted rates for seniors and residents of Auburn Hills. The nearby city of Pontiac is only 5 miles away. For long-distance travel, Oakland County International Airport is about 15 miles from the community.
